To find the value of h∘g(a), we need to substitute g(a) into the function h.
Since g(x) = 2x, we have g(a) = 2a.
Now we can substitute 2a into h(x) = x^2 + 4:
h∘g(a) = (2a)^2 + 4
= 4a^2 + 4.
Therefore, the value of h∘g(a) is 4a^2 + 4.
